About Angelo Del Gaudio
Angelo Del Gaudio is a scholar working on Gastroenterology, Biological Psychiatry and Genetics, having authored 16 papers that have together received 659 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Inflammatory Bowel Disease (7 papers), Gastrointestinal motility and disorders (3 papers), Pancreatic and Hepatic Oncology Research (3 papers), Gut microbiota and health (3 papers), Neuroendocrine Tumor Research Advances (2 papers), Liver Disease Diagnosis and Treatment (2 papers), Cancer Immunotherapy and Biomarkers (2 papers) and Autoimmune and Inflammatory Disorders Research (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Biological Psychiatry (47 citations), Gastroenterology (45 citations) and Physiology (173 citations). Angelo Del Gaudio has collaborated with scholars based in Italy and United States. Frequent co-authors include Federica Di Vincenzo, Franco Scaldaferri, Loris Riccardo Lopetuso, Valentina Petito, Antonio Gasbarrini, Marcello Candelli, Enrico Celestino Nista, Francesco Franceschi, Alfredo Papa and Tommaso Schepis. Their work appears in journals such as Biomedicines, Cancers, Nutrients, Journal of Clinical Medicine and International Journal of Molecular Sciences.
